I'm looking at a fitting a heavy duty bumper (possibly a Tubular one), so it possible on a 300tdi to fit a winch as i want to keep my air con?
-
I should think so, they do exist with the winch sat ahead of the grille. What about a removable one? keeps you pedestrian friendly, thief unfriendly and won't increase the front axle loading.

you can have a disco 300tdi winch bumper, you just ask for an aircon version, as they say the winch section sits more forwards so the winch is up against the grill, as opposed to chopped grill and in / behind it.

I have a Scorpion Racing bumper with a Warn 9.5 XP on a 300 with aircon, the whole lot came off my 200 without aircon. I know it's not the bumper you want but it does show that certain ones will fit no problem.
